Transaction 55b9954f77080a04c69a4aae955aab77b105974041357465e3338725b33d9993

1 Input
2 Outputs
  • 55b9954f77080a04c69a4aae955aab77b105974041357465e3338725b33d9993:0
  • value  285022814
    address  3HCb6DuPRLWXf2zogSFA8H4ahSyR3Up5tA
  • 55b9954f77080a04c69a4aae955aab77b105974041357465e3338725b33d9993:1
  • value  549923616
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s